M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ES AND PURPOSE A Post Completion Paralegal in the Residential New Homes Department to assist with post completion requirements of the Department and to provide support to the Post Completion Team Leader. MAIN DUTIES To exhibit flexibility, particularly during peak times of the year; To review clients documents before submission to the Land Registry; Submit AP1s to the Land Registry; Update lender portals with OS2s and when AP1s have been submitted; To handle any requisitions that arise and liaising with third parties where necessary; Update lenders, including portals, on delayed registrations when requested; Submit OS2 searches on any cancelled application to protect lenders interest; Update the completions spreadsheet on OneDrive; To submit registrations to the NHBC/LABC etc obtain the insurance certificates and send to client (and lender if necessary); To send completed documents to clients, lenders and HTB where applicable; Ensure NHBC Certificates and OCEs/Filed Plans are stored electronically on DPS. To ensure that all balances are clear on completed matters; To archive completed matters; Dealing with post completion queries from clients; Dealing with old matter queries; The following tasks provide a general overview of the types of activity, the candidate will be expected to engage in or oversee on a day-to-day basis. Leeds Conservatoire is a music conservatoire located in the Quarry Hill district of Leeds. It provides a variety of undergraduate, foundation and postgraduate degrees in music, dance & drama related subject areas. It also offers a variety of short courses, and organise frequent concerts, festivals and events. Its emphasis on practical training, creative industry links, help ensure it provides a vibrant artistic community for students.
